One formula for a person's maximum heart rate is 220 − x, where x is the person's age in years for 20 ≤ x ≤ 70. The American Heart Association recommends that when a person exercises, the person should strive for a heart rate that is at least 50% of the maximum and at most 85% of the maximum. (Source: American Heart Association)
(a) Write and graph a system of inequalities that describes the exercise target heart rate region.
(b) Find two solutions of the system and interpret their meanings in the context of the problem.
2. A warehouse supervisor has instructions to ship at least 50 bags of gravel that weigh 55pounds each and at least 40 bags of stone that weigh 70pounds each. The maximum weight capacity of the truck being used is 7500 pounds.
(a) Write and graph a system that describes the numbers of bags of stone and gravel that can be shipped.
(b) Find two solutions of the system and interpret their meanings in the context of the problem.
